Who is that girl at the top of the page?

It's a self-portrait by Sofonisba Anguissola. She was one of the key figures in developing the personality-filled style of portraits used in the Touchstone Tarot deck. She said, "Life is full of surprises, I try to capture these precious moments with wide eyes." How different her style was from the idealised, generic style of portraiture that came before her. No vacuous Madonnas for her - there were real, sultry, fiery eyes in the women she painted.
